import { JSDOM } from 'jsdom';
import config from '../config';
import { intersperse } from '../prelude/array';
import { MfmForest, MfmTree } from './prelude';
import { IMentionedRemoteUsers } from '../models/entities/note';
import { wellKnownServices } from '../well-known-services';
export function toHtml(tokens: MfmForest | null, mentionedRemoteUsers: IMentionedRemoteUsers = []) {
if (tokens == null) {
return null;
}
const { window } = new JSDOM('');
const doc = window.document;
function appendChildren(children: MfmForest, targetElement: any): void {
for (const child of children.map(t => handlers[t.node.type](t))) targetElement.appendChild(child);
}
const handlers: { [key: string]: (token: MfmTree) => any } = {
bold(token) {
const el = doc.createElement('b');
appendChildren(token.children, el);
return el;
},
small(token) {
const el = doc.createElement('small');
appendChildren(token.children, el);
return el;
},
strike(token) {
const el = doc.createElement('del');
appendChildren(token.children, el);
return el;
},
italic(token) {
const el = doc.createElement('i');
appendChildren(token.children, el);
return el;
},
fn(token) {
const el = doc.createElement('i');
appendChildren(token.children, el);
return el;
},
blockCode(token) {
const pre = doc.createElement('pre');
const inner = doc.createElement('code');
inner.textContent = token.node.props.code;
pre.appendChild(inner);
return pre;
},
center(token) {
const el = doc.createElement('div');
appendChildren(token.children, el);
return el;
},
emoji(token) {
return doc.createTextNode(token.node.props.emoji ? token.node.props.emoji : `\u200B:${token.node.props.name}:\u200B`);
},
hashtag(token) {
const a = doc.createElement('a');
a.href = `${config.url}/tags/${token.node.props.hashtag}`;
a.textContent = `#${token.node.props.hashtag}`;
a.setAttribute('rel', 'tag');
return a;
},
inlineCode(token) {
const el = doc.createElement('code');
el.textContent = token.node.props.code;
return el;
},
mathInline(token) {
const el = doc.createElement('code');
el.textContent = token.node.props.formula;
return el;
},
mathBlock(token) {
const el = doc.createElement('code');
el.textContent = token.node.props.formula;
return el;
},
link(token) {
const a = doc.createElement('a');
a.href = token.node.props.url;
appendChildren(token.children, a);
return a;
},
mention(token) {
const a = doc.createElement('a');
const { username, host, acct } = token.node.props;
const wellKnown = wellKnownServices.find(x => x[0] === host);
if (wellKnown) {
a.href = wellKnown[1](username);
} else {
const remoteUserInfo = mentionedRemoteUsers.find(remoteUser => remoteUser.username === username && remoteUser.host === host);
a.href = remoteUserInfo ? (remoteUserInfo.url ? remoteUserInfo.url : remoteUserInfo.uri) : `${config.url}/${acct}`;
a.className = 'u-url mention';
}
a.textContent = acct;
return a;
},
quote(token) {
const el = doc.createElement('blockquote');
appendChildren(token.children, el);
return el;
},
text(token) {
const el = doc.createElement('span');
const nodes = (token.node.props.text as string).split(/\r\n|\r|\n/).map(x => doc.createTextNode(x) as Node);
for (const x of intersperse<Node | 'br'>('br', nodes)) {
el.appendChild(x === 'br' ? doc.createElement('br') : x);
}
return el;
},
url(token) {
const a = doc.createElement('a');
a.href = token.node.props.url;
a.textContent = token.node.props.url;
return a;
},
search(token) {
const a = doc.createElement('a');
a.href = `https://www.google.com/search?q=${token.node.props.query}`;
a.textContent = token.node.props.content;
return a;
}
};
appendChildren(tokens, doc.body);
return `<p>${doc.body.innerHTML}</p>`;
}
